Description

Lithographic Sketches of the Public Characters of Calcutta is a remarkable historical document that captures the essence of Calcutta’s social and political landscape during a significant period. Through detailed lithographic illustrations accompanied by descriptive text, C. Grant presents portraits and characterizations of the city’s most influential and notable public figures.

This work serves as both an artistic endeavor and a historical record, providing valuable insights into the lives, professions, and social standing of Calcutta’s prominent citizens. The lithographic medium, popular during the 19th century, adds authenticity and artistic merit to the collection. The book offers researchers, historians, and art enthusiasts a window into the colonial period’s urban society, capturing the personalities who shaped Calcutta’s development and influenced its cultural landscape.
